Does anyone have advice on how I can "re-add" a 5 year old tradeline back to my Equifax credit report. Equifax deleted two good-standing mortgage accounts from my credit report apparently because they were closed accounts. However, it hasn't been 5 years since the date of last activity.
Hi, and welcome to the forums.
This is a tough one. They dont' HAVE to report, so there's no way to force them to through any type of regulation or rule. Do you have an older copy of your report that shows the tradelines? All I can suggest is that you send a copy to EQ and ask them if they can pick up the reporting again.
I don't know if you would have any luck trying to get the mortgage company to try to re-report if there is no activity. It might be worth a phone call.
